Class Agent
- java.lang.Object
-
- com.softlayer.api.Type
-
- com.softlayer.api.service.Entity
-
- com.softlayer.api.service.ticket.Attachment
-
- com.softlayer.api.service.ticket.attachment.assigned.Agent
-
@ApiType("SoftLayer_Ticket_Attachment_Assigned_Agent") public class Agent extends Attachment
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
Agent.Mask
-
Field Summary
Fields Modifier and Type Field Description protected Customer
assignedAgent
protected Long
assignedAgentId
The internal identifier of an assigned Agent that is attached to a ticket.protected boolean
assignedAgentIdSpecified
protected Customer
resource
-
Fields inherited from class com.softlayer.api.service.ticket.Attachment
attachmentId, attachmentIdSpecified, createDate, createDateSpecified, id, idSpecified, ticket, ticketId, ticketIdSpecified
-
Fields inherited from class com.softlayer.api.Type
unknownProperties
-
-
Constructor Summary
Constructors Constructor Description Agent()
-
Method Summary
Modifier and Type Method Description Customer
getAssignedAgent()
Long
getAssignedAgentId()
Customer
getResource()
boolean
isAssignedAgentIdSpecified()
void
setAssignedAgent(Customer assignedAgent)
void
setAssignedAgentId(Long assignedAgentId)
void
setResource(Customer resource)
void
unsetAssignedAgentId()
-
Methods inherited from class com.softlayer.api.service.ticket.Attachment
getAttachmentId, getCreateDate, getId, getTicket, getTicketId, isAttachmentIdSpecified, isCreateDateSpecified, isIdSpecified, isTicketIdSpecified, setAttachmentId, setCreateDate, setId, setTicket, setTicketId, unsetAttachmentId, unsetCreateDate, unsetId, unsetTicketId
-
Methods inherited from class com.softlayer.api.Type
getUnknownProperties, setUnknownProperties
-
-
-
-
Field Detail
-
assignedAgent
@ApiProperty protected Customer assignedAgent
-
resource
@ApiProperty protected Customer resource
-
assignedAgentId
@ApiProperty(canBeNullOrNotSet=true) protected Long assignedAgentId
The internal identifier of an assigned Agent that is attached to a ticket.
-
assignedAgentIdSpecified
protected boolean assignedAgentIdSpecified
-
-
Method Detail
-
getAssignedAgent
public Customer getAssignedAgent()
-
setAssignedAgent
public void setAssignedAgent(Customer assignedAgent)
-
getResource
public Customer getResource()
-
setResource
public void setResource(Customer resource)
-
getAssignedAgentId
public Long getAssignedAgentId()
-
setAssignedAgentId
public void setAssignedAgentId(Long assignedAgentId)
-
isAssignedAgentIdSpecified
public boolean isAssignedAgentIdSpecified()
-
unsetAssignedAgentId
public void unsetAssignedAgentId()
-
-